Your Modern IT Initiative is Probably Already Dated

Your Modern IT Initiative is Probably Already Dated

What's considered cutting-edge can quickly become outdated. A recent conversation with a friend, who was excited about his new company's modern IT setup, highlighted this. Despite their advanced infrastructure, it was already behind the times. This scenario is common in many businesses where the allure of the latest technology can sometimes be misleading.

The Rapid Pace of Technological Change

The reality is that technology evolves at an incredible pace. Businesses that believe they're at the forefront of technological advancement may find themselves outdated if they're not continually adapting. Staying current requires a strategic approach to technology adoption, rather than simply chasing the latest trends.

Complexity and Staff Proficiency

Introducing new technologies without a clear strategy can lead to unnecessary complexity. This not only increases costs but also demands higher proficiency from staff, leading to questions about the practicality and cost-effectiveness of such systems. Over-customization can lead to a desire to revert to simpler, off-the-shelf solutions.

Accumulating Technical Debt

Frequent changes in IT infrastructure can result in significant technical debt. This happens when time and resources are invested in trendy technologies that quickly become obsolete or cumbersome, leaving businesses stuck maintaining them.

Evaluating New Technologies

For medium to large-sized companies, having an innovations department can be crucial. Such a department's role is to explore new technologies and assess their fit within the existing infrastructure. A good example is the integration of sensors for safety improvements, which can be a valuable addition.

Discerning Technology Adoption

Not all new technologies will be beneficial. The innovations department should evaluate potential use cases, like the exploration of Mix-Reality Headsets, and decide whether they serve the company's needs. This cautious approach prevents unnecessary integration into the production environment.

Trendy Experimentation

Software development is often a field of experimentation. For instance, incorporating multiple JavaScript libraries into a .NET environment because it's trendy can lead to obsolescence and maintenance challenges for new developers.

Strategic and Measured Steps

Businesses, especially well-established ones, should approach modernization incrementally. Rushing into modernization without a strategic plan can lead to more problems than solutions.


Read this article and others on my website:

https://www.dinocajic.com/your-modern-it-initiative-is-probably-already-dated/

要查看或添加评论,请登录

Dino Cajic的更多文章

  • Benefits of Custom Software Development for Small Businesses

    Benefits of Custom Software Development for Small Businesses

    The benefits of custom software development are many, and it’s a good idea for any small business to consider it. While…

    2 条评论
  • Strategic Atomic Habits

    Strategic Atomic Habits

    I just started listening to the Atomic Habits audio book and I can relate more than I’ve ever related to any book. It’s…

  • Moderate Daily Self Improvement Strategy

    Moderate Daily Self Improvement Strategy

    Why does this feel controversial to talk about? I know that it shouldn’t be, to encourage others to want to improve…

  • How a Software Development Project Can Get Dragged Out Indefinitely

    How a Software Development Project Can Get Dragged Out Indefinitely

    I had a conversation recently that was related to going 2 years over the proposed timeline. The question that I was…

  • Business Continuity Strategy

    Business Continuity Strategy

    Developing business continuity strategies is a critical responsibility for the CIO. If you’ve wondered by reading…

  • The CIO’s Role in Business Continuity Planning

    The CIO’s Role in Business Continuity Planning

    Someone has to plan for disaster. The CIO normally takes on the role of business continuity planner.

  • Custom ERP System for Your Organization

    Custom ERP System for Your Organization

    The more I interact with various organizations, the more the issues seem to align. Custom ERP solutions can solve…

    2 条评论
  • Why Are Developers Stressed Out?

    Why Are Developers Stressed Out?

    Software development, known for its challenging environment, often brings a unique set of stressors. Let's explore…

  • 10 Things I Wish I Knew When I Started Programming

    10 Things I Wish I Knew When I Started Programming

    The Learning Journey in Programming Limitless Learning: The vastness of programming knowledge is overwhelming. Focus on…

  • A Practical Guide To Building An App

    A Practical Guide To Building An App

    Before diving into app development, it's crucial to understand your target audience. This involves researching existing…

社区洞察

其他会员也浏览了